BENDED REALITY.COM
venus-clouds-01
Dark Streaks Seen on Venus’ Clouds be Alien Microbes

The question of life on Venus, of all places, is intriguing enough that a team of U.S. and Russian scientists working on a proposal for a new mission to the second planet—named Venera-D—are considering including the search for life in its mission goals. If all goes as planned, an unmanned aerial vehicle could one day be cruising the thick, sulfuric … Continue reading

© 2015-2023 BENDED REALITY.COM

Close